Some people love insects and others absolutely hate them. I can’t count how many of my friends are terrified of insects. I have one friend who jumps and screams at the sight of the tiniest bug. He’s over forty years old! My son loves insects. He has many books on them and knows everything about them. He loves going to insect museums and watching nature documentaries on insects. I also love them. I think insects are fascinating. I can watch them for hours. I also love looking at them in zoos and museums. It’s like looking at a tiny miniature world. I think if I was insect-sized, life would be pretty scary. Or even worse, what if one day there were giant insects roaming the streets. That’s the stuff of horror movies.
